## Customer Reviews

### ⭐⭐⭐⭐ 







  
  
    Perfect Halloween story
  

*by A***. on Reviewed in the United States on October 8, 2018*

4.5 Stars -- Great read from Robert McCammon! I won't say that this stands up to Swan Song or Boys Life, his classics, but this was definitely a great book from an author who, at the time, was branded a horror writer, and was finally finding his voice and stretching his wings. From all I've been hearing, his first four books (including They Thirst) are just okay. Nothing special. Then it was around the time Mystery Walk came out (which I've yet to read) was when the Robert we know now, started to bloom.This book hit all the right notes with me. I loved how awful the Usher family was. The more I hate characters, the better I love the book. It means it's doing its job! I enjoyed the historical moments, mainly when we see Rix studying in the library researching his ancestors, or hearing tales about mysterious family members. This books takes us back to the 1800s many times, to hear anecdotes about various Usher adventures. I loved the supernatural element also! Since I was blind going into this book, I wasn't sure what to expect and had no clue as to where the story was going to go. Every twist was a pleasant surprise. Speaking of twists, there were some plot twists in this book that my jaw hanging. One left me disappointed... not in the story itself, but disappointed in the character itself.I'm glad I got a chance to read this, it has been a long time coming. I've had this on my Kindle queue for a while. I couldn't have chosen a better time to read it, what a way to kick off the October horror season!

### ⭐⭐⭐⭐ 







  
  
    A Well Written and Entertaining Novel
  

*by C***S on Reviewed in the United States on April 23, 2020*

When I first started reading this book, I thought it would be a historical fiction novel featuring Edgar Allen Poe and the Usher family that he wrote about over a century ago.  It turned out to be set in modern day.  I was hoping for historical fiction given that McCammon is terrific as an author in that genre.  Having said that, Usher’s Passing did not disappoint.It was an interesting and imaginative tale.  In this world, the Usher family is one of the wealthiest in the world, with their fortune tied to the sale of arms.  Rix Usher is the outcast of the family.  He’s a horror writer (I imagine Robert McCammon put some elements of himself into this character).  He’s vehemently against the family business but returns to their compound in North Carolina with his father dying.  Although Rix doesn’t want anything to do with the family business, he wants to write an expose/history of the family in sordid detail.  But what lurks beneath the surface is the supernatural and how the family has been able to achieve the fortune through ties with otherworldly forces.There are some nice twists and turns in this novel.  The main baddie here is the Pumpkin Man, a supernatural character who has been abducting children for decades.  When the reveal was finally made about the Pumpkin Man’s identity, I was surprised.  It was a well delivered set up that made sense in retrospect but caught me off guard.  I thought there was good character development in this novel, with a good many memorable characters.  The writing was strong and purposeful.  The supernatural elements mixed in well with the parts that were grounded in reality.  My only negative was that I felt it dragged in certain parts and could have used some trimming to make it a tighter story.Carl Alves - author of The Invocation
